excel表格怎么求百分号

excel表格怎么求百分号

在Excel表格中求百分号的方法包括使用百分比格式、公式计算百分比、利用百分比函数。下面将详细介绍其中的一种方法:使用百分比格式。这种方法是最简单直观的,也是大多数用户最常用的一种方法。首先,选择需要转换为百分比的单元格或数据区域,然后在Excel工具栏中找到"百分比样式"按钮,点击即可完成转换。这样,原本的小数将自动转换成百分比格式,且在单元格中显示出百分号。

一、百分比格式

百分比格式是Excel中最常用的格式之一,它能够快速将数字转化为百分比。这种方法特别适合处理已经存在的小数数据,将其直接转换为百分比形式。

百分比格式的基本操作

  1. 选择数据区域:首先,选择你需要转换为百分比的单元格或数据区域。这一步非常关键,因为只有选中的单元格会被应用格式。
  2. 应用百分比样式:在Excel工具栏的"数字"组中找到"百分比样式"按钮。点击这个按钮,选中的数据将会自动转换为百分比格式,且在单元格中显示出百分号。
  3. 调整小数位数:如果需要调整百分比的小数位数,可以在“数字”组中找到“增加小数位数”或“减少小数位数”按钮,根据需求进行调整。

百分比格式的注意事项

  • 数据类型:确保你选中的数据是数值类型,而不是文本类型。文本类型的数据无法直接应用百分比格式。
  • 小数与百分比的关系:转换后的百分比实际上是将小数乘以100。例如,0.75转换为百分比就是75%。

二、公式计算百分比

使用公式计算百分比是一种更加灵活和精确的方法,适合需要进行复杂计算的场景。

基本公式

百分比计算的基本公式是:(部分值 / 总值) * 100%。这个公式可以帮助你计算任意部分值占总值的百分比。

实际操作步骤

  1. 输入公式:在目标单元格中输入公式,例如=A1/B1*100,其中A1是部分值,B1是总值。这个公式将计算A1占B1的百分比。
  2. 应用百分比格式:为了使结果显示为百分比,可以再次使用"百分比样式"按钮。

实际案例

假设你有一张考试成绩表,A列是学生得分,B列是总分。你希望计算每个学生的得分百分比。可以在C1单元格中输入公式=A1/B1*100,然后将这个公式拖动填充到C列的其他单元格中。这样,每个学生的得分百分比就计算出来了。

三、利用百分比函数

Excel提供了一些内置函数,可以简化百分比计算。

使用PERCENTRANK函数

PERCENTRANK函数可以帮助你计算一个值在数据集中的百分比排名。

  1. 基本语法=PERCENTRANK(array, x, [significance]),其中array是数据集,x是你要计算的值,significance是小数位数。
  2. 实际操作:假设你有一组数据在A列,你希望计算A2单元格的百分比排名,可以在B2单元格中输入公式=PERCENTRANK(A:A, A2)

使用PERCENTILE函数

PERCENTILE函数可以帮助你找到某个百分位数对应的值。

  1. 基本语法=PERCENTILE(array, k),其中array是数据集,k是百分位数(0-1之间)。
  2. 实际操作:假设你有一组数据在A列,你希望找到第90百分位数,可以在B1单元格中输入公式=PERCENTILE(A:A, 0.9)

四、百分比的实际应用

百分比在实际工作中有着广泛的应用,下面列举几个常见的应用场景。

财务报表分析

在财务报表中,百分比常用于利润率、成本率、增长率等指标的计算。通过计算这些指标,可以更直观地了解公司的财务状况。

市场调查

在市场调查中,百分比常用于计算市场份额、满意度、购买意向等指标。通过计算这些指标,可以更准确地了解市场情况和消费者需求。

成绩分析

在教育领域,百分比常用于计算学生的得分率、班级平均分、通过率等指标。通过计算这些指标,可以更科学地评价学生的学习效果。

五、处理异常值

在实际操作中,有时会遇到一些异常值,这些值可能会对百分比计算产生影响。如何处理这些异常值也是一个需要考虑的问题。

排除异常值

在计算百分比时,可以先对数据进行预处理,排除一些明显的异常值。这可以通过筛选、排序等方法实现。

使用数据清洗工具

Excel提供了一些数据清洗工具,可以帮助你快速处理异常值。例如,可以使用“条件格式”来标记异常值,然后手动排除这些值。

使用更复杂的统计方法

在一些复杂的场景中,可以考虑使用更复杂的统计方法,如标准差、四分位距等,来处理异常值。这些方法可以帮助你更科学地处理数据,提高计算结果的准确性。

六、百分比的可视化

在Excel中,可以使用图表来可视化百分比,使数据更直观。

饼图

饼图是展示百分比的常用图表之一,可以直观地展示各部分在整体中的占比。

  1. 创建饼图:选择数据区域,然后在“插入”选项卡中选择“饼图”。
  2. 调整饼图样式:可以通过“图表工具”来调整饼图的样式,如颜色、标签等。

条形图

条形图也是展示百分比的常用图表之一,特别适合比较多个数据项的百分比。

  1. 创建条形图:选择数据区域,然后在“插入”选项卡中选择“条形图”。
  2. 调整条形图样式:可以通过“图表工具”来调整条形图的样式,如颜色、标签等。

百分比堆积图

百分比堆积图可以展示多个数据项的百分比,并且各部分的百分比加起来总是100%。

  1. 创建百分比堆积图:选择数据区域,然后在“插入”选项卡中选择“堆积柱形图”或“堆积条形图”。
  2. 调整堆积图样式:可以通过“图表工具”来调整堆积图的样式,如颜色、标签等。

七、使用宏来自动化计算

在一些复杂的场景中,可以使用宏来自动化百分比的计算和格式化。

创建宏

  1. 打开宏录制器:在“开发工具”选项卡中选择“录制宏”。
  2. 录制操作:按步骤进行操作,如选择数据、应用百分比格式等。
  3. 保存宏:完成操作后,停止录制并保存宏。

运行宏

  1. 打开宏:在“开发工具”选项卡中选择“宏”。
  2. 选择宏并运行:选择你创建的宏,然后点击“运行”。

通过宏可以自动化一些重复性的操作,提高工作效率。

八、使用VBA进行高级计算

对于一些更复杂的计算,可以使用VBA(Visual Basic for Applications)编程来实现。

基本语法

VBA是一种编程语言,可以在Excel中进行各种复杂的操作。基本的VBA语法包括变量声明、条件判断、循环等。

实际案例

假设你有一组数据在A列,你希望计算每个数据的百分比排名并显示在B列。可以使用以下VBA代码:

Sub CalculatePercentRank()

Dim rng As Range

Dim cell As Range

Dim total As Double

Dim i As Integer

Dim percentRank As Double

Set rng = Range("A1:A10") '假设数据在A1到A10

total = Application.WorksheetFunction.CountA(rng)

For Each cell In rng

i = i + 1

percentRank = Application.WorksheetFunction.Rank(cell.Value, rng) / total

cell.Offset(0, 1).Value = percentRank

Next cell

End Sub

通过运行这个宏,可以计算A列中每个数据的百分比排名并显示在B列。

九、百分比计算的常见问题及解决方法

小数点精度问题

在实际操作中,可能会遇到小数点精度的问题,导致计算结果不准确。

  1. 解决方法:可以通过调整小数位数或使用ROUND函数来解决这个问题。例如,=ROUND(A1/B1*100, 2)可以将结果保留两位小数。

数据类型问题

有时候数据类型不正确也会导致计算错误。例如,将文本类型的数据误认为数值类型。

  1. 解决方法:可以使用VALUE函数将文本类型的数据转换为数值类型。例如,=VALUE(A1)可以将A1单元格中的文本转换为数值。

空值和零值问题

空值和零值在百分比计算中也常常引起问题。

  1. 解决方法:可以使用IF函数来处理空值和零值。例如,=IF(B1=0, 0, A1/B1*100)可以避免除以零的错误。

十、总结

在Excel中求百分号的方法多种多样,包括使用百分比格式、公式计算百分比和利用百分比函数等。每种方法都有其独特的优势和适用场景。通过本文的详细介绍,希望能帮助你更好地理解和掌握这些方法,提高工作效率。在实际操作中,可以根据具体需求选择最合适的方法,并结合使用数据清洗工具、图表可视化、宏和VBA编程等高级技巧,进一步提升数据处理的能力。

相关问答FAQs:

1. 为什么在Excel表格中使用百分号?
在Excel表格中使用百分号可以将数据以百分比的形式显示,方便进行比较和分析。百分比可以表示相对比例,使数据更加直观易懂。

2. 如何在Excel表格中将数值转换为百分比?
要将数值转换为百分比,在Excel表格中选中需要转换的单元格或区域,然后选择“开始”选项卡上的“百分比”按钮。这将把选中的数值转换为百分比形式,并在单元格中显示百分号。

3. 如何在Excel表格中计算百分比?
如果要计算两个数值之间的百分比,可以使用Excel的公式。例如,要计算A1单元格的值占B1单元格的百分比,可以在另一个单元格中输入以下公式:=A1/B1*100%。这将给出A1值占B1值的百分比。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4307734

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部